Brief summary

An exploratory single-centre randomized clinical trial was performed in order to investigate whether the fluid volume administered during esophageal carcinoma surgery affects pulmonary gas exchange and tissue perfusion.

Detailed description

A convenience sample of 16 patients admitted to the Department of Thoracic surgery University Hospital Centre Zagreb and scheduled for esophageal carcinoma surgery were enrolled prospectively in the study between June 2011 and August 2012. Patients were randomly allocated into two groups, one of which received ≤ 8ml/kg/h of intraoperative fluid (restrictive group) and another that received \> 8 ml/kg/h of fluid (liberal group). Patients were excluded if they were younger than 18 years; if they had severe lung disease, chronic renal insufficiency, or a physical status classification \> III on the American Society of Anesthesiologists (ASA) scale; or if it was impossible to perform epidural catheter placement or thoraco-phreno-laparotomy. All patients underwent esophagectomy carried out according to the Lewis-Tanner approach. Data on arterial oxygen partial pressure (PaO2), inspired oxygen fraction (FiO2), and the ratio PaO2/FiO2 were collected 10 min after anesthesia was induced and again 6 h after surgery. Data on the metabolic markers creatinine and lactate were collected 10 min after anesthesia induction and 6 h after surgery. ANOVA tests were performed to determine significant differences in mean values between study groups. Independent-sample t-tests were used to test differences in mean values between the restrictive and liberal groups for each of the two sets of measurements separately (10 minutes after anesthesia induction and 6 hr after surgery). P \< 0.05 was considered significant.

Interventions

A group of patients who received ≤ 8ml/kg/h of intraoperative fluid during esophageal carcinoma surgery. The fluid administered: Plasma-Lyte 148 (pH 7.4; Viaflo, Baxter, US), 10% Aminoven (Fresenius Kabi AG, Bad Homburg, Germany) at 0.5 ml/kg/h, 5 ml/kg of colloid (6% Voluven 130/0.4, Fresenius Kabi AG, Bad Homburg, Germany), packed red blood cells.

A group of patients who received \> 8 ml/kg/h of intraoperative fluid during esophageal carcinoma surgery. The fluid admnistered: Plasma-Lyte 148 (pH 7.4; Viaflo, Baxter, US), 10% Aminoven (Fresenius Kabi AG, Bad Homburg, Germany) at 0.5 ml/kg/h, 5 ml/kg of colloid (6% Voluven 130/0.4, Fresenius Kabi AG, Bad Homburg, Germany), packed red blood cells.

Primary

Pulmonary Gas Exchange During and After Esophageal Carcinoma Surgery (PaO2/FiO2 Ratio)

At the given time point, 10 minutes after beginning of the Lewis Tanner procedure and 6 hours after, arterial oxygen partial pressure (PaO2), inspired oxygen fraction (FiO2), and the PaO2/FiO2 ratio will be measured. The results of Pa02/FiO2 ratio will be compared between two groups for each time point separately.

Time frame: 10 minutes, 6 hours

ArmMeasureGroupValue (MEAN)Dispersion
Restrictive GroupPulmonary Gas Exchange During and After Esophageal Carcinoma Surgery (PaO2/FiO2 Ratio)10 minutes345.01 mmHgStandard Deviation 35.31
Restrictive GroupPulmonary Gas Exchange During and After Esophageal Carcinoma Surgery (PaO2/FiO2 Ratio)6 hours315.51 mmHgStandard Deviation 32.91
Liberal GroupPulmonary Gas Exchange During and After Esophageal Carcinoma Surgery (PaO2/FiO2 Ratio)10 minutes330.11 mmHgStandard Deviation 34.71
Liberal GroupPulmonary Gas Exchange During and After Esophageal Carcinoma Surgery (PaO2/FiO2 Ratio)6 hours307.11 mmHgStandard Deviation 30.31
Comparison: The measurement was assessed at 10 minutes time point.p-value: 0.41t-test, 1 sided
Comparison: The measurement was assessed at 6 hours time point.p-value: 0.621t-test, 1 sided
